Jinyu Liang is a scholar working on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Hepatology and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Jinyu Liang has authored 68 papers receiving a total of 1.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 19 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, 18 papers in Hepatology and 15 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Jinyu Liang's work include Hepatocellular Carcinoma Treatment and Prognosis (17 papers), Ultrasound and Hyperthermia Applications (11 papers) and Thyroid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(11 papers). Jinyu Liang is often cited by papers focused on Hepatocellular Carcinoma Treatment and Prognosis (17 papers), Ultrasound and Hyperthermia Applications (11 papers) and Thyroid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(11 papers). Jinyu Liang coll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Japan. Jinyu Liang's co-authors include Ming‐De Lu, Xiaoyan Xie, Zuo‐Feng Xu, Guangjian Liu, Yanling Zheng, Hui‐Xiong Xu, Wei Wang, Li‐Da Chen, Zhu Wang and Luyao Zhou and has published in prestigious journals such as Cancer, Materials Science and Engineering A and Life Sciences.
